Title: **Yoshihiro Ishikawa: Innovator in Mobile Communication Technology**

Introduction

Yoshihiro Ishikawa is an accomplished inventor based in Yokosuka, Japan, known for his significant contributions to the field of mobile communication technology. With a remarkable portfolio of 51 patents, Ishikawa has advanced innovative methods and apparatuses that facilitate seamless communication.

Latest Patents

Among Ishikawa's latest patents is a groundbreaking design for a receiving apparatus and method. This invention allows for the efficient reception of downlink signals with discontinuous pilot symbols. The apparatus includes several key components: a unit for extracting reference signals, a signal generation unit that employs inverse Fourier transform techniques, and a functionality to calculate received power based on generated signals.

Another noteworthy patent is for a femto base station designed to optimize transmission power of communication channels. This invention includes a downlink perch channel signal transmission power controller that adjusts transmission power based on specific conditions, as well as an uplink reception sensitivity controller to enhance performance.

Career Highlights

Yoshihiro Ishikawa has made substantial contributions while working for prominent companies in the telecommunications industry, including NTT Docomo, Inc. and NTT Mobile Communications Network, Inc. His work in these organizations has positioned him as a leader in innovating practical solutions to address the ever-evolving demands of mobile communication.

Collaborations

Throughout his career, Ishikawa has collaborated with notable colleagues such as Seizo Onoe and Mikio Iwamura. These partnerships have played a crucial role in the development of pioneering technologies and have fostered a creative environment that encourages the exchange of ideas.
